What is PIPP? PIPP stands for Personal Injury Protection Plan, and all Manitoba residents have injury claims coverage whether they own a vehicle or not. PIPP also covers visitors to Manitoba who are injured in an accident if a Manitoba registered vehicle is involved. Coverage also extends to all Manitoba residents if injured outside the province in Canada or the United States.

As a PIPP Payment & Records Clerk, you will be a part of the dynamic team that assists in converting all incoming PIPP related injury claim documentation into electronic format. The receipt and proper validation of this information triggers a workflow for the appropriate users to ensure timely claim management.

**Responsibilities**:

- Process payments in accordance with established procedures, standards, guidelines and fee schedules and best practices guidelines.
- Verify invoices and account details for completeness, validity, valuation and authorization.
- Ensure that reserves, coverages and preauthorization of goods/services exist on a claim prior to processing an invoice for payment.
- Enter invoice data and ensure invoice and payment details are correct.
- Receive and physically prepare documents for the scanning process. This includes batching documents based on document type and provider and identifying and confirming claim numbers on all incoming documents.
- Review scanned images to confirm legibility and correct issues as required.
